Abstract

The embodiment of the invention provides an accurate measurement method and device based on a virtual three-dimensional space. The method comprises: acquiring coordinate information of a measurement point in the virtual three-dimensional space; wherein the measurement points comprise a first measurement point and a second measurement point, and the coordinate information comprises first coordinateinformation of the first measurement point and second coordinate information of the second measurement point; calculating the linear distance between the first measurement point and the second measurement point according to the first coordinate information and the second coordinate information; connecting the first measuring point and the second measuring point through a straight line, and displaying the straight line and the straight line distance. According to the accurate measurement method and device based on the virtual three-dimensional space provided by the embodiment of the invention,the linear distance between the first measurement point and the second measurement point is calculated and displayed by acquiring the coordinate information of the first measurement point and the second measurement point in the virtual three-dimensional space, so that automatic accurate measurement of the distance between the two measurement points in the virtual three-dimensional space is realized. The measurement efficiency is improved, and the measurement cost is reduced.
